Without them, there is no one to govern and no reason for a state to exist. States and their populations have unique cultures, histories, traditions, and values. Territory A state has established boundaries. For example, the borders of the United States are recognized by its citizens, its neighbors, and the international community. The exact shape of political boundaries is often a source of conflict among states. Territorial boundaries may change as a result of war, negotiations, or purchase. Sovereignty The key characteristic of a state is sovereignty. Political sovereignty means the state has supreme and absolute authority within its boundaries. It has complete independence and power of the make laws and foreign policy and determine its coure of action. In theory, at least, on state has the right to interfere with the internal affairs of another state. Government States must have someone in change. A government makes and enforces its own laws for its own people. Government provides leadership, maintains order, provides public services, offers defense and security, and makes decisions about how to establish economic security for its people.
